QCP Capital, a Singapore-based crypto investment firm, posted on social media that BTC rebounded from the $60,000 region to $63,700 after breaking the $60,000 support level last week, opening the first trading day of the second half of the year. BTC spot ETF inflows also continued to recover, with net inflows reaching $73 million last Friday, the highest daily net inflow level in the past two weeks.

From a seasonal perspective, BTC's median return in July was 9.6%, especially after a negative June (-9.85%). QCP Capital's options trading desk also observed fund flows last Friday, which may have seen an uptick in anticipation of the launch of the Ethereum spot ETF. All signs point to a bullish July.
